Town of Center - Building Department
The building permit authority for the Town of Center, which straddles Saguache and Rio Grande counties. The Town of Center operates its own building permitting under its Public Works Department rather than delegating to either county; building-related forms are submitted to the Public Works Department.
Town of Crestone - Building Permits
The building permit authority for the Town of Crestone, Saguache County. The Town states it has no building code; the Town Clerk's office reviews and issues building permits directly, with the Planning Commission consulted for extenuating circumstances. Permits are issued for additions, remodels, accessory dwelling units, single- and multi-unit residences, mobile homes, perimeter fences, sheds, and shipping containers; the Town's building permit checklist and residential permit application do not list re-roofing or roofing work among the categories requiring a permit.
Town of Moffat - Building Permits
The building permit authority for the Town of Moffat, Saguache County (distinct from Moffat County in northwestern Colorado). The Town requires building permits under its own ordinances - the Town's documents index lists "Ordinance 2011-1 Building Permits" and "Ordinance 2019-09 Requiring Building Permits" alongside downloadable "Building Permit - Commercial" and "Building Permit - Residential" application forms - with the Town Clerk handling permit applications. No adopted I-code edition is named on the Town's site, and no roofing-specific permit category is listed.
Town of Saguache Building Site Permits
The building permit authority for the Town of Saguache, in Saguache County and the San Luis Valley. The Town issues its own "Application for Building Site Permit," which explicitly lists "Roof Replacement" as a checked project category — in contrast to Saguache County, whose own Land Use FAQ states a building permit is NOT required to replace a roof in the unincorporated county. The Town's roofing requirement is a documented divergence from the county's stance.
